Question 1058723: The logistic growth function below describes the number of people, f(t), who became ill with the flu “t” weeks after its initial outbreak in a particular community.
f(t)=200,000/1+2000e^-t
(a) How many people became ill with the flu when the epidemic began? (round to the nearest whole number) Answer: 100
(b) How many people were ill by the end of the fourth week? (round to the nearest whole num-ber)
(c) What is the limiting size of the population that became ill? EXPLAIN in words please Answer by josmiceli(19441) (Show Source):
